## Changelog — Featherkit defaults

Heads up, new folks: Featherkit (our shared component library) now defaults to strict semver. Previously, minor bumps could sneak in breaking prop changes — that's over. Breaking changes require a major bump and a migration note, enforced in CI. Pinned ranges in consumer apps were widened to caret ranges during the sweep, so updates flow automatically. If a release looks stuck, check the publish gate. The versioning pipeline runs with these settings.

service settings:
ulaael:
  log_level: warn
  metrics_host: metrics.ulaael.tolvaqsys.internal
  pin: 7801
  pool_size: 16

Step 7: Turn on websocket compression for Glimmerport. Quick heads-up for review: compression on websockets can leak info if attacker-controlled data shares a frame with secrets (the classic compress-then-encrypt problem), so we only enable it on the telemetry channel, never on auth frames. Set SOCKET_COMPRESSION=permessage-deflate in .env and cap window bits at 12 to keep memory bounded per connection. Compressed channels still authenticate with the stream signing secret, which must live in the same .env. Drop that secret in on the next line.

sealed setting: LEDGER_TOKEN13=5d842615a26d7

Ticket: Config drift on the Stallport occupancy feed.

External plugin authors have reported that the garage occupancy feed's polling cadence differs between the documented values and what the sandbox actually serves. Root cause: the sandbox cluster was not updated after the March cadence change, so stale thresholds remain in place. Until the sandbox is realigned, plugins should code against the intended production configuration, which is reproduced below for reference.

service settings:
PRAIX_LOG_LEVEL=error
PRAIX_METRICS_HOST=metrics.praix.qorvelcorp.corp
PRAIX_POOL_SIZE=16